-
公开(公告)号:US11516321B1
公开(公告)日:2022-11-29
申请号:US16711073
申请日:2019-12-11
Applicant: Juniper Networks, Inc.
Abstract: A network device may receive, from a timing source of a network, timing information. The network device may identify a client device to which the timing information is to be provided, wherein the network device provides an interface between the client device and the network. The network device may select a virtual network address to associate with a timing agent of the network device, wherein the virtual network address is within an address range that is reachable by the client device. The network device may provide to the client device, and via a network layer communication, a timing control packet comprising the timing information, wherein the timing control packet identifies the virtual network address as a source network address of the timing control packet, and wherein the timing information is to be used by the client device to update a clock of the client device.
-
公开(公告)号:US12021657B1
公开(公告)日:2024-06-25
申请号:US18304427
申请日:2023-04-21
Applicant: Juniper Networks, Inc.
Inventor: Wen Lin , Ravi Shekhar , Vamshi Krishna Voruganti , Aldrin Isaac , SelvaKumar Sivaraj , Sean A. Mentzer , John E. Drake
IPC: H04L12/46 , H04L12/66 , H04L45/50 , H04L61/5007 , H04L101/622
CPC classification number: H04L12/4641 , H04L12/66 , H04L45/50 , H04L61/5007 , H04L2101/622
Abstract: A first provider edge device may receive device information from a second provider edge device included in an Ethernet virtual private network (EVPN). The device information may identify a media access control (MAC) address and may indicate that the device is connected to the second provider edge device. The first provider edge device may receive data transmitted by the device and may determine, based on information included in the data, that the device has moved from the second provider edge device to the first provider edge device. The first provider edge device may generate a data packet including mobility information indicating that the device has moved to the first provider edge device. The first provider edge device may transmit, via a data plane of the EVPN, the data packet to the second provider edge device to permit the second provider edge device to update routing information for the device.
-
公开(公告)号:US11677586B1
公开(公告)日:2023-06-13
申请号:US17443500
申请日:2021-07-27
Applicant: Juniper Networks, Inc.
Inventor: Wen Lin , Ravi Shekhar , Vamshi Krishna Voruganti , Aldrin Isaac , SelvaKumar Sivaraj , Sean A. Mentzer , John E. Drake
IPC: H04L12/46 , H04L45/50 , H04L12/66 , H04L61/5007 , H04L101/622
CPC classification number: H04L12/4641 , H04L12/66 , H04L45/50 , H04L61/5007 , H04L2101/622
Abstract: A first provider edge device may receive device information from a second provider edge device included in an Ethernet virtual private network (EVPN). The device information may identify a media access control (MAC) address and may indicate that the device is connected to the second provider edge device. The first provider edge device may receive data transmitted by the device and may determine, based on information included in the data, that the device has moved from the second provider edge device to the first provider edge device. The first provider edge device may generate a data packet including mobility information indicating that the device has moved to the first provider edge device. The first provider edge device may transmit, via a data plane of the EVPN, the data packet to the second provider edge device to permit the second provider edge device to update routing information for the device.
-
公开(公告)号:US11770466B2
公开(公告)日:2023-09-26
申请号:US17938717
申请日:2022-10-07
Applicant: Juniper Networks, Inc.
CPC classification number: H04L69/28 , H04L12/18 , H04L12/4641 , H04L45/50 , H04L45/64 , H04L45/72 , H04L61/5007
Abstract: A network device may receive, from a timing source of a network, timing information. The network device may identify a client device to which the timing information is to be provided, wherein the network device provides an interface between the client device and the network. The network device may select a virtual network address to associate with a timing agent of the network device, wherein the virtual network address is within an address range that is reachable by the client device. The network device may provide to the client device, and via a network layer communication, a timing control packet comprising the timing information, wherein the timing control packet identifies the virtual network address as a source network address of the timing control packet, and wherein the timing information is to be used by the client device to update a clock of the client device.
-
公开(公告)号:US11323392B1
公开(公告)日:2022-05-03
申请号:US16947099
申请日:2020-07-17
Applicant: Juniper Networks, Inc.
Inventor: Sushant Kumar , Aldrin Isaac , SelvaKumar Sivaraj
IPC: H04L49/55 , H04L43/0811 , H04L45/24 , H04L45/02 , H04L45/16 , H04L41/0654 , H04L41/0659
Abstract: Techniques are described for managing a split-brain scenario in a multihomed environment by exchanging isolation information between a leaf device and two or more spine devices to which the leaf device is multihomed via a link aggregation group (LAG). The techniques include selecting one of the spine devices as a primary spine device and determining, based on the isolation information, whether the spine devices are isolated from each other. In the split-brain scenario in which all of the spine devices are isolated from each other, the primary spine device is configured to maintain the LAG with the leaf device while the other spine devices mark the LAG with the leaf device as down. In this way, in the split-brain scenario, the leaf device may continue to send traffic to other leaf devices in the leaf layer using the LAG to the primary spine device.
-
公开(公告)号:US11115330B2
公开(公告)日:2021-09-07
申请号:US15957345
申请日:2018-04-19
Applicant: Juniper Networks, Inc.
Inventor: Selvakumar Sivaraj , Wen Lin , Praful Lalchandani , Aldrin Isaac , Deepti J. Chandra , Vishal Garg
IPC: H04L12/741 , H04L12/46 , H04L12/24 , H04L29/12 , H04L29/08 , H04L12/721 , H04L12/761 , H04L12/707 , H04L12/723 , H04L12/18
Abstract: A device may receive, from a provider edge device, a packet to be provided to one or more other provider edge devices. Some of the one or more other provider edge devices may be multi-homed with a same customer edge device as the provider edge device. The device may configure a source IP address of the packet based on a capability of an assisted replicator device after receiving the packet. The capability may relate to whether the assisted replicator device is capable of retaining the source IP address of the packet as received from the provider edge device. The device may provide the packet to at least some provider edge devices, of the one or more other provider edge devices, after configuring the source IP address of the packet.
-
公开(公告)号:US11088871B1
公开(公告)日:2021-08-10
申请号:US16788072
申请日:2020-02-11
Applicant: Juniper Networks, Inc.
Inventor: Wen Lin , Ravi Shekhar , Vamshi Krishna Voruganti , Aldrin Isaac , SelvaKumar Sivaraj , Sean A. Mentzer , John E. Drake
IPC: H04L12/46 , H04L29/12 , H04L12/66 , H04L12/723
Abstract: A first provider edge device may receive device information from a second provider edge device included in an Ethernet virtual private network (EVPN). The device information may identify a media access control (MAC) address and may indicate that the device is connected to the second provider edge device. The first provider edge device may receive data transmitted by the device and may determine, based on information included in the data, that the device has moved from the second provider edge device to the first provider edge device. The first provider edge device may generate a data packet including mobility information indicating that the device has moved to the first provider edge device. The first provider edge device may transmit, via a data plane of the EVPN, the data packet to the second provider edge device to permit the second provider edge device to update routing information for the device.
-
-
-
-
-
-